zzt Posted March 21, 2017 Share Posted March 21, 2017 Mixing and matching certainly can be a problem. While you can take a lot off the frame rails of an STI to fit a Caspian slide, you cannot necessarily go the other way. The best way is to check with the manufacturer first, or buy you components from a supplier who offers returns or exchange. Here is an example. I have a new JEM Guns frame with rails that are .755" wide. I have a new STI slide with slide ways measuring .757" wide and a new Caspian slide with ways measuring .752" wide. Guess which one I'll have to use.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
